The Western Australia cricket team, also known as the Western Warriors, is one of the six state teams that compete in the Sheffield Shield and the Marsh One-Day Cup in Australia. The team is based in Perth and represents the state of Western Australia in domestic cricket competitions.

The Western Australia team has a rich history of success in Australian domestic cricket, having won the Sheffield Shield multiple times. The team has produced many talented cricketers who have gone on to represent Australia at the international level.
